Being confident during a session

When you're facilitating a session try to:

  • be brave and go for it, everyone wants the session to go well
  • start with your plan and expect the unexpected. It’s rare for everything to go exactly as you expect but that's ok
  • research your session content and audience well so that you can be confident and step in when you need to
  • find the balance between allowing discussion and moving the conversation on
  • trust your gut feelings and adapt the approach based on how your group responds
  • ask your group how they can best use the time if things start to go off-track
